arduino-cli throws invalid number literal on core update index #61

Hello everybody,

currently the package_azureboard_index.json is broken, because it has a whitespace in the size literal, so the arduino-cli will throw a

Error updating index: invalid package index in https://raw.githubusercontent.com/VSChina/azureiotdevkit_tools/master/package_azureboard_index.json: json: invalid number literal, trying to unmarshal ""3788484 "" into Number

when you try to update the index of cores on MacOS with arduino-cli 0.17.0.

Steps to reproduce:

  1. Install arduino-cli, see the offical arduino-cli installation guide
  2. Create a configuration file: `arduino-cli config init``
  3. Open config file and add https://github.com/VSChina/azureiotdevkit_tools/blob/master/package_azureboard_index.json as additional url:
    Example:
board_manager:
  additional_urls: [https://raw.githubusercontent.com/duglah/azureiotdevkit_tools/master/package_azureboard_index.json]
  1. Run arduino-cli core update-index
